2. The Data We Collect We may collect, use, and store different types of personal data about you. This includes:

  • Identity Data: Your first name, last name, and title.

  • Contact Data: Your billing address, delivery address, email address, and telephone numbers.

  • Financial Data: Payment details for our services. Note: We use a third-party payment processor, and we do not store your full payment card details.

  • Transaction Data: Details about payments to and from you and other details of the services you have purchased from us.

  • Technical Data: Internet Protocol (IP) address, your login data, browser type and version, time zone setting and location, browser plug-in types and versions, operating system and platform, and other technology on the devices you use to access our website.

  • Usage Data: Information about how you use our website, products, and services.

  • Communications Data: Your preferences in receiving marketing from us and our third parties, and your communication preferences. This also includes records of our correspondence with you, such as inquiries or complaints.

  • Consignment Data: The name, address, and contact information of the person sending or receiving a parcel, as well as details about the contents of the item.

4. How and Why We Use Your Data (Lawful Basis) We will only use your personal data when the law allows us to. Most commonly, we will use your personal data in the following circumstances:

  • To perform a contract with you: This includes processing your personal and consignment data to fulfill our courier services, manage your account, and process payments.

  • Where it is necessary for our legitimate interests: This allows us to improve our services, grow our business, and inform our marketing strategy. This includes analysing how customers use our services and personalising your experience on our website.

  • Where we have a legal obligation: This may include sharing data with authorities if required by law.

  • With your consent: We will rely on your consent to send you direct marketing communications via email or text message. You have the right to withdraw this consent at any time.

7. Your Legal Rights Under UK data protection laws, you have rights in relation to your personal data. You have the right to:

  • Request access to your personal data.

  • Request correction of your personal data.

  • Request erasure of your personal data.

  • Object to processing of your personal data.

  • Request the restriction of processing of your personal data.

  • Request the transfer of your personal data.

  • Withdraw consent to marketing at any time.
